Rodrin This research study aimed to determine the income and employment of high school graduates employed in selected business locators of Cavite. Specifically, it aimed to determine: the socio-demographic profile of high school graduates employed in selected business locators of Cavite; the status of employment of high school graduates employed in selected business locators of Cavite; the monthly income of high school graduates employed in selected business locators of Cavite; the relationship between the socio-demographic profile of employed high school graduates and their income; the relationship between the income of employed high school graduates and their status of employment; and the problems encountered by the employed highschool graduates in their present employment. The study was conducted from November 4, 2013 to December 12, 2013 in selected business locators of Cavite such as Cavite Economic Zone, Cavite Carmona Industrial Estate and First Cavite Industrial Estate. Fishbowl sampling technique was used to select the three companies or agencies in each of the three business locators of Cavite. The information regarding the total number of employed highschool graduates in selected business locators of Cavite was gathered from the human resource department of three selected companies or agencies in each of the three business locators of Cavite. The total population of employed high school graduates was 4,216. Quota proportionate sampling was applied to determine the number of participants to be interviewed. Stratified proportionate sampling was employed to determine the number of participants per company in each business locator. Convenience sampling was used in selecting the participants from each business locator. A total of 200 participants was the target sample size of the study. Data on socio-demographic profile, status of employment and monthly income of employed high school graduates were analyzed using descriptive statistical tools such as frequency count, percentages, means and ranges. Ranking was used to present the problems encountered by the employed high school graduates. The chi-square test was used to determine the relationship between the socio-demographic profile of employed high school graduates and their income and the relationship of their income to their status of employment. The results of the analysis showed that 71 percent were male and 29 percent were female with mean age of 25 years, majority of the participants were single had 1 to 4 dependents and most of them had 1 to 5 household members. Twenty two percent of them were married while 1 percent each was widower and separated, respectively. All of the participants were assigned in production area. Majority of them were employed on a contractual basis with an average of 51.34 months length of service. The results of chi-square test showed that socio-demographic profile such as sex, civil status, number of dependents, and household size were found not significant to the income of the participants, while their age was found to be significantly related to their income. The status of employment such as length of service and nature of appointment were found significantly related to the income of the participants.
